Summary:The throughput of PDP/LCD production is decreased by the scratch of the FPD glass surface that is occurred by line or plane contact when FPD glass is transferred or stacked in manufacturing process of PDP/LCD. In order to prevent the decrease of the throughput, the paper or film is coated on the surface of FPD glass. This is one of very important processes in PDP/LCD manufacturing and the solution of problem to be scratched on surface of FPD glass is very important for the chemical treatment of the surface in FPD post-process, ITO and electrode formation process. In this study, the developed system to coat protecting film on FPD glass without using any adhesive agent is applied to the manufacturing process of the next generation of PDP/LCD.
